Shooting with the zebra pattern
You can set the camcorder to display a zebra pattern (diagonal stripes) in the portion of the
picture on the LCD screen or in the viewfinder with a subject whose brightness exceeds a
certain level. The portion of the picture where zebra pattern appears is an area of high
brightness and overexposure. You can check the picture level of a subject by displaying the
zebra pattern. Use the zebra pattern as a guide for adjusting the exposure and shutter speed
so that you can get the desired picture.
Set the ZEBRA selector to 70 or 100.
To erase the zebra pattern
Set the ZEBRA selector to OFF.
Settings of the ZEBRA selector
Setting
Meaning
70
The zebra pattern appears in the portion of the picture on the LCD
screen or in the viewfinder with a subject whose brightness is about
70 IRE (70%).
100
The zebra pattern appears in the portion of the picture on the LCD
screen or in the viewfinder with a subject whose brightness exceeds
more than 100 IRE (100%).
OFF
The zebra pattern does not appear on the LCD screen or in the
viewfinder.
Note on shooting with the zebra pattern
Even though you see the zebra pattern on the LCD screen or in the viewfinder, the zebra
pattern is not recorded.
